    Unity Theatre

    Posted by sturdylegs 7 January 2008

    A great show for the price of a round of drinks.
    Some of the best new dance I've seen (Memento Mori, Tanya Khabarova).

    The best of the Edinburgh fringe and brand spanking new plays so fresh they still creak a little bit.

    Occasionally the purveyors of arty nonsense. You can always leg it at the half if it's bad. Some great theatre and the odd hilarious turkey.

    Green Fish Cafe

    Posted by sturdylegs 7 January 2008

    Vegetarian Whole food Cafe

    A top tip for a tasty lunch for around a fiver. Funky exhibitions from local artists. Cool tunes in an ambient style. Live music provided by a resident harpist.

    It's a chance to rub shoulders with the Scouse literati and wrap your lips round a stonking beanburger.

    Toilet needs nerves of steel, stout heart and effortless self confidence.

    Bistro Jaques

    Posted by sturdylegs 7 January 2008

    Bistro on Hardman Street - great food and good service at low prices. Good range of limited menu deals, lunch £6.95 for three courses 12:00-16:30.

    It's packed most of the time so it's best to book.
